The werewolves ran across the desert of no return with full speed, heading for the camp set at the border of the village of angels. Their growls and thundering of the earth beneath was enough to announce their arrival.

At the front of the thousands of wolves was a single grey wolf. He led the army as they approached the border and shifted into his human form without warning causing the wolves behind him to skid to a stop. He then approached Greg and his men, both parties leaving a few meters between them.

Haven hid behind Aeon who blocked her from seeing what was going on. She still heard a bit of the heated argument though and most of it was about her.

“A mate? Are you kidding me?” The leader burst into laughter “Who on earth told you the Alpha had a mate?”

Greg was confused “What nonsense are you spewing, Lyrus? If he isn’t looking for his mate, then why such an absurd demand?”

Lyrus frowned. “The Alpha doesn’t have a mate”
